Pat Williams' 'Dead Rising: Endgame', a sequel in the video game adaptation cinematic universe, grapples with the inherent challenges of translating interactive survival horror to the silver screen. Eschewing mere gratuitous action, the film attempts to delve into the psychological aspects of survival amidst a zombie pandemic and the fight against misinformation. Jesse Metcalfe reprises his role as reporter Chase Carter, delivering a consistent performance, albeit one that doesn't quite elevate the script's overall quality. While Keegan Connor Tracy and Dennis Haysbert have their moments, they struggle to transcend the limitations of a somewhat shallow narrative.
Williams' directorial approach strives for tension, yet it's frequently undercut by inconsistent visual effects and uneven pacing. The zombie combat sequences, while energetic, often lack the characteristic creative absurdity and dark humor synonymous with the Dead Rising game series' unique weaponry. The film appears caught between desiring to be a serious zombie thriller and retaining the quirky spirit of its source material. Its standing within the crowded zombie subgenre exemplifies the difficulties of game adaptations, where the core essence of the interactive experience often becomes diluted by conventional cinematic tropes.
